Values Clarification Therapists in North Dakota

Values clarification provides an opportunity to consider what is truly important to us, and if we are living in a way that is in line with our core values. Values often guide our thoughts, actions, and feelings, and when we’re acting in a way that’s out-of-line with our values, we may feel an uncomfortable dissonance.
